When can babies have salmon?
Your little one can try her first serving of salmon whenever shestarts solids, usually sometime around 6 months.
Offer salmon flaked in small pieces, taking care to remove any tiny bones.
(Run your fingers around the salmon pieces to check.)
Be sure to cut the skin into thin, finger-sized strips.

Can babies be allergic to salmon?
Allergies to finned fish (like salmon, tuna or halibut) are less common than allergies to shellfish.
(And being allergic to one doesnt mean youll be allergic to the other.)
Whats more, up to 40 percent of finned fish allergies dont develop until adulthood.
Is salmon a choking hazard for babies?
Fish bones can be a choking risk for babies and young children.
Serve salmon and other finned fish safely by removing all bones and offering it in age-appropriate pieces.
